About this plan
The Book of Psalms stands as one of Scripture's most beloved and emotionally honest collections of prayers and songs. Written across centuries by various authors—including King David, Asaph, and others—the Psalms give voice to the full spectrum of human experience before God. Whether expressing deep despair, exuberant joy, confusion, or profound gratitude, the Psalms teach us that every emotion can be brought authentically to our Creator.
In our modern world, we often compartmentalize our faith, believing we must approach God only with polished prayers and composed hearts. The Psalms shatter this misconception. They model a raw, honest spirituality where doubt coexists with faith, where lament transforms into praise, and where questioning becomes a pathway to deeper trust. 🎵
